flight shame
US /flaɪt ʃeɪm/
UK /flaɪt ʃeɪm/
Noun
a feeling of guilt or embarrassment about traveling by airplane because of the negative impact of aircraft carbon emissions on the environment
Example:
•
Due to flight shame, she decided to take the train across Europe instead of flying.
•
The movement of flight shame has led to a significant increase in rail travel in Sweden.
